The assigned reading was always too much for me. I can't read hundreds of pages of textbooks. I pulled the majority of my information from the PowerPoints and then would look back at any reading I thought I needed more clarification on, specifically what was listed on exam blueprints.

The further into to this program I have gotten, the more disappointing it has been. Recycled lectures and instructors that don't seem to know what content is actually being covered in them. Then the whole having to find your own preceptor has been a major pain in the *** as well.

You get what you pay for. This is an affordable program, and ultimately it will give me what I need to take the exam for my license. 

Not trying to rain on anyone's parade, just hoping to manage expectations a little. This is probably how a lot of these programs are. Ultimately it is up to you to do the learning necessary to be successful. Good luck.
